T - Channel Typepublic class StandardChannelInitializer<T extends io.netty.channel.Channel>
extends io.netty.channel.ChannelInitializer<T>
| Modifier and Type | Field and Description |
|---|---|
private Supplier<List<io.netty.channel.ChannelHandler>> |
handlerSupplier |
private Duration |
idleTimeout |
private Duration |
writeTimeout |
| Constructor and Description |
|---|
StandardChannelInitializer(Supplier<List<io.netty.channel.ChannelHandler>> handlerSupplier)
Standard Channel Initializer with handlers
|
| Modifier and Type | Method and Description |
|---|---|
protected void |
initChannel(io.netty.channel.Channel channel) |
void |
setIdleTimeout(Duration idleTimeout)
Set the idle timeout period for channel connections, monitoring both read and write times
|
void |
setWriteTimeout(Duration writeTimeout)
Set Timeout for Write operations
|
channelRegistered, exceptionCaught, handlerAdded, handlerRemovedpublic void setWriteTimeout(Duration writeTimeout)
writeTimeout - Write Timeoutpublic void setIdleTimeout(Duration idleTimeout)
protected void initChannel(io.netty.channel.Channel channel)
initChannel in class io.netty.channel.ChannelInitializer<T extends io.netty.channel.Channel>Copyright © 2024 Apache NiFi Project. All rights reserved.